Comprehensive Service Overview
Roofing projects in New Canton typically fall into a few broad categories: repairs, replacements, and storm-related work. Given the range of property ages and styles in this area, there's no one-size-fits-all approach.
For repairs, the most common needs involve fixing leaks around flashing, replacing damaged shingles after storms, and addressing moss or algae buildup that has compromised older roofing materials. A thorough inspection is usually the starting point—identifying the source of water intrusion rather than just patching the symptom. Clear findings and photo documentation help property owners understand exactly what's happening up there.
Full replacements become necessary when a roof has reached the end of its service life, often after 20-30 years depending on the material. In New Canton, asphalt shingles are the most common choice, but metal roofing has gained popularity for rural properties and outbuildings due to its durability and longevity. Proper ventilation and flashing are critical in this climate, where attic moisture can lead to bigger problems down the road.
For storm-related concerns, quick assessments after wind or hail events can help property owners document conditions and make informed decisions. Photo documentation of any damage is especially useful if you plan to involve insurance—having a clear record of conditions makes the process smoother.
Material choices vary based on the property. Asphalt shingles remain popular for their affordability and proven performance. Metal roofing is often chosen for its longevity and resistance to the elements. Tile and flat roofing systems are less common here but appear on specific property types. The key is matching the material to the property's structure, slope, and exposure.

Regional Characteristics
New Canton sits in the heart of Buckingham County, a largely rural area with a mix of historic homes, working farms, and newer residential developments. Housing stock varies widely—you'll find everything from 19th-century farmhouses with steep-pitch roofs to modern ranch-style homes and rural commercial buildings. The terrain is rolling hills with wooded lots, and the climate is humid subtropical, meaning roofs deal with heat, humidity, heavy rain, and occasional winter ice. Many properties are set back from main roads, which can add considerations for material delivery and access.
Common Issues
Weather-related wear is the most common concern. Humidity and shade promote moss and algae growth on asphalt shingles, particularly on north-facing slopes and tree-covered lots. Storm damage from high winds and falling limbs is frequent. Older homes may have aging original roofs or multiple layered shingles that need careful evaluation. Flashing issues around chimneys, vents, and valleys are common on properties of all ages, and ice damming can occur during colder snaps.

Local Considerations
New Canton is a small, unincorporated community in Buckingham County, centered near the intersection of Routes 15 and 652. The area is primarily rural, with the James River defining parts of the landscape. Many residents commute to nearby towns like Dillwyn, Scottsville, and Farmville, and properties range from historic homes to newer construction in developing subdivisions throughout the county.
